Join ASI educator Anna Ruhland to learn about different techniques to create a textile collage. Students will practice embroidery and felting skills on a variety of textile materials to create colorful collages. Starting with Slöjd is a monthly program for early elementary students who want to start crafting! Whether it’s playing with wool, wire, paper, or more, this group will explore new tools, materials, and skills that prepare kids for a lifelong love of slöjd (handcraft). ASI designed these drop-off programs for students in grades K-2.
